Copper State Credit Union is a member-owned financial cooperative based in Arizona, providing a range of personal and business banking products and services to its members.

Key Statistics

As of December 2025, public records show Copper State Credit Union has originated approximately $126.8M in loan volume over the past 12 months, with an average loan size of $459k.

What type of lender is Copper State Credit Union?

Copper State Credit Union is classified as an credit union based on our research. Credit unions are member-owned, not-for-profit financial cooperatives. They have a mix of business (29%) and personal loans in their portfolio.

What entities does Copper State Credit Union fund loans under?

Copper State Credit Union originates mortgages through 5 different lending entities. The most common include Deer Valley Credit Union, Integro Bank, and Copper State Capital Retiremen. These are the legal entity names that appear on recorded mortgage documents.

Where is Copper State Credit Union most active?

Based on recorded mortgages, Copper State Credit Union is most active in Arizona, California, and Florida.
